===ASBC Modification Using Mass===
Here we present an alternative calculation for measuring titratable acidity. The ASBC method requires both an accurate measurement for of both beer volume and density. Depending on the quality of lab equipment available, these measurements can have variable error bars. In general, more accurate mass scales are more affordable than similarly accurate volume or density instruments; therefore, only using the beer and acid mass will lead to a more consistent measurement. Additionally, small gravity differences don't have a large impact when using the ASBC calculation. The following calculation for TA does not use specific gravity.
For a numerical exampleof this alternative calculation for TA, assume 15mL beer, 5mL 0.1M NaOH:
